Court order allows Occupy Wall St. protesters back
http://news.yahoo.com/court-order-allows-occupy-wall-st-protesters-back-135130959.html

NEW YORK (AP) — Hundreds of police officers in riot gear raided Zuccotti Park early Tuesday, evicting dozens of Occupy Wall Street protesters from what has become the epicenter of the worldwide movement protesting corporate greed and economic inequality.

Hours later, the National Lawyers Guild obtained a court order allowing Occupy Wall Street protesters to return with tents to the park. The guild said the injunction prevents the city from enforcing park rules on Occupy Wall Street protesters.

At a morning news conference at City Hall, Mayor Michael Bloomberg said the city knew about the court order but had not seen it and would go to court to fight it. He said the city wants to protect people's rights, but if a choice must be made, it will protect public safety.

6. New York City Council Member Hit And Arrested During Police Raid Zuccotti Park
http://www.huffingtonpost.com/2011/11/15/ydanis-rodriguez-arrested-hit-occupy-wall-street-raid_n_1094645.html

"Ydanis Rodriguez, New York City Council Member, was hit in the head and arrested during last night's police raid on Zuccotti Park.

According to The New York Times, he was with a group near the intersection of Broadway and Vesey Street that was attempting to link up with protesters at Zuccotti Park. The group tried to push through a line of officers trying to prevent people from reaching the park. Mr. Rodriquez was arrested and charged with disorderly conduct and resisting arrest.

...Jumaane D. Williams, council member of the 45th district, and colleague of Rodriguez confirmed the arrest this morning via Twitter and that Rodriguez was "bleeding from the head thanks to NYPD."
